常量#
常量 |
類型 |
解釋 |
---|---|---|
mlx90640.FPS1HZ |
number |
FPS1HZ |
mlx90640.FPS2HZ |
number |
FPS2HZ |
mlx90640.FPS4HZ |
number |
FPS4HZ |
mlx90640.FPS8HZ |
number |
FPS8HZ |
mlx90640.FPS16HZ |
number |
FPS16HZ |
mlx90640.FPS32HZ |
number |
FPS32HZ |
mlx90640.FPS64HZ |
number |
FPS64HZ |
mlx90640.init(i2c_id,refresh_rate) (注意:2023.5.15之后使用此接口,用戶需要自行初始化i2c接口)
初始化MLX90640傳感器
參數(shù)
傳入值類型 |
解釋 |
---|---|
int |
傳感器所在的i2c總線id或者軟i2c對(duì)象,默認(rèn)為0 |
int |
傳感器的測(cè)量速率,默認(rèn)為4Hz |
返回值
返回值類型 |
解釋 |
---|---|
bool |
成功返回true, 否則返回nil或者false |
例子文章來源:http://www.zghlxwxcb.cn/news/detail-738326.html
i2c.setup(i2cid,i2c_speed) if mlx90640.init(0,mlx90640.FPS4HZ) then log.info("mlx90640", "init ok") sys.wait(500) -- 稍等片刻 while 1 do mlx90640.feed() -- 取一幀數(shù)據(jù) mlx90640.draw2lcd(0, 0 ,1)-- 需提前把lcd初始化好 sys.wait(250) -- 默認(rèn)是4HZ end else log.info("mlx90640", "init fail") end
mlx90640.feed()
取一幀數(shù)據(jù)
參數(shù)
無文章來源地址http://www.zghlxwxcb.cn/news/detail-738326.html
返回值
無
例子
無
mlx90640.raw_data()
獲取底層裸數(shù)據(jù),浮點(diǎn)數(shù)矩陣
參數(shù)
無
返回值
返回值類型 |
解釋 |
---|---|
table |
浮點(diǎn)數(shù)數(shù)據(jù),768個(gè)像素對(duì)應(yīng)的溫度值 |
例子
無
mlx90640.raw_point(index)
獲取單一點(diǎn)數(shù)據(jù)
參數(shù)
傳入值類型 |
解釋 |
---|---|
int |
索引值(0-767) |
返回值
返回值類型 |
解釋 |
---|---|
number |
單點(diǎn)溫度值 |
例子
無
mlx90640.ta_temp()
獲取外殼溫度
參數(shù)
無
返回值
返回值類型 |
解釋 |
---|---|
number |
外殼溫度 |
例子
無
mlx90640.max_temp()
獲取最高溫度
參數(shù)
無
返回值
返回值類型 |
解釋 |
---|---|
number |
最高溫度 |
number |
最高溫度位置 |
例子
無
mlx90640.min_temp()
獲取最低溫度
參數(shù)
無
返回值
返回值類型 |
解釋 |
---|---|
number |
最低溫度 |
number |
最低溫度位置 |
例子
無
mlx90640.average_temp()
獲取平均溫度
參數(shù)
無
返回值
返回值類型 |
解釋 |
---|---|
number |
平均溫度 |
例子
無
mlx90640.get_vdd()
獲取vdd
參數(shù)
無
返回值
返回值類型 |
解釋 |
---|---|
number |
vdd |
例子
無
mlx90640.draw2lcd(x, y, fold)
繪制到lcd
參數(shù)
傳入值類型 |
解釋 |
---|---|
int |
左上角x坐標(biāo) |
int |
左上角y坐標(biāo) |
int |
放大倍數(shù),必須為2的指數(shù)倍(1,2,4,8,16…)默認(rèn)為1 |
返回值
返回值類型 |
解釋 |
---|---|
bool |
成功返回true,否則返回false |
例子
無
到了這里,關(guān)于LuatOS-SOC接口文檔(air780E)--mlx90640 - 紅外測(cè)溫(MLX90640)的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!